Trump Mediates Ceasefire in Thailand-Cambodia Border Conflict

Escalating Tensions on the Border

The border conflict between Thailand and Cambodia has intensified over the past few days, marking the deadliest clash between the two nations in over a decade. Reports indicate that the violence, which began near disputed border areas, has now spread to provinces approximately 200 miles south of the initial skirmish zones. As of the latest updates, at least 33 people have been killed, and more than 168,000 individuals have been displaced due to the ongoing hostilities.

Thai health authorities have reported significant casualties, with 14 deaths attributed to Cambodian attacks. In response, Thailand has conducted cross-border air attacks, further escalating the situation. Both nations have traded accusations of initiating fresh attacks, with each side claiming provocation as the violence entered its third day on July 26.

Trump's Diplomatic Intervention

In a surprising turn of events, President Donald Trump has stepped in to mediate the conflict, leveraging his influence to push for peace. While on a golf trip in Scotland, Trump announced that he had engaged in discussions with leaders from both Thailand and Cambodia. He described the talks as 'very good' and expressed optimism that both sides are eager to reach a ceasefire agreement.

Trump has also tied the resolution of this conflict to trade negotiations, issuing a stern warning that he will not entertain trade deals with either nation until the fighting ceases. 'I told them there will be no trade deals while the fighting rages,' Trump stated, emphasizing his stance on prioritizing peace before economic agreements. This ultimatum has added pressure on both countries to de-escalate tensions swiftly.

The international community has echoed Trump's call for a ceasefire, with mounting pressure on Thailand and Cambodia to halt hostilities. The U.S. president's involvement has brought significant attention to the crisis, with hopes that his mediation will lead to a breakthrough in negotiations scheduled to address the immediate cessation of violence.

Path Forward Amidst Uncertainty

As ceasefire talks loom on the horizon, the focus remains on whether Thailand and Cambodia can set aside their differences to prevent further loss of life and displacement. The border dispute, rooted in longstanding territorial disagreements, requires not only an immediate halt to violence but also a long-term resolution to prevent future conflicts.

President Trump's role as a mediator has introduced a new dynamic to the situation, intertwining diplomatic efforts with economic incentives. While the exact outcomes of the upcoming talks are uncertain, the commitment from both nations to engage in dialogue offers a glimmer of hope. The world watches closely as these Southeast Asian neighbors navigate this critical juncture, with the potential for peace resting on the success of these crucial negotiations.
